Spine related injuries occur from many circumstances including:
- Whiplash associated disorders and injuries from car accidents (ICBC)
- Work place injury (WCB coverage)
- Sports injury
- A slip or fall
- Physical weakness
- Tension, anxiety, nervousness
- Back pain from pregnancy
- Children's activities
- * Most common: Poor posture: Poor posture causes the structure of our spine to weaken; which in turn weakens the muscles and the joints needed to keep us upright and strong. Most people are unaware of how their posture is affecting their development and overall health. Many arthritic conditions are aggravated, worsened or caused by poor posture, causing injuries that go undetected for years. Just like a car tire may wear unevenly if unbalanced, so will your spine, hips, knees and associated structures. YOU DO NOT NEED TO HAVE PAIN TO HAVE A SERIOUS POSTURAL PROBLEM.
